The Harry Moseley Story – Making it Happen is a true account of how a ‘normal’ little boy with big dreams and a selfless, compassionate outlook on life proves that with hard work, anything can be achieved. This is an emotional, heart-warming and truly inspirational account of how a little boy’s dream of helping others changed the lives of millions and will probably make you take a look at yourself in the process Harry gripped the nation by making and selling beaded bracelets all by himself, with all the proceeds he raised going to charity. When Harry passed away in October 2011 he had raised a staggering £650,000 for his chosen charities but his legacy lives on. During his fight against brain cancer Harry befriended many people via his Twitter account including his peers and many famous celebrities from all over the world. In 2012, a charity ‘Help Harry Help Others’ was set up to carry on his work.
